1.Serum Insulin-like Growth Factor Binding Proteins Profiles During the Normal Oulatory Menstrual Cycle.
Korean Journal of Fertility and Sterility 1999;26(1):67-73
The insulin-like growth factor (IGF)s are believed to one of several growth factors that play an adjunctive role in ovarian follicular development. These factors circulate bound to a family of IGF-binding protein (IGFBP)s. It is known that circulating IGFBPs are involved in the transport of IGFs to tissues and modulate IGFs actions at local tissue. The purposes of this study were to evaluate changes in serum IGFBPs profiles during normal ovulatory menstrual cylce and to compare serum IGFBPs profiles in periovulatory phase of between normal ovulatory menstrual cylce and controlled hyperstimulated cycle. Fasting blood samples were obtained from 15 normal healthy women throughout normal ovulatory menstural cycle and on the day of aspiration of oocyte from 10 patients undergoing ovarian hyperstimuation for in vitro fertilization-embryo transfer. Serum IGFBP-1-IGFBP-4 were measured by western ligand blot and immunoprecipitation. Serum 17beta-estradiol was determined by radioimmunoassay. Type and molecular weight of serum IGFBP did not changed during normal ovulatory menstural cycle. No significant variation in the relative proportion and level of each IGFBP was found throughout normal ovulatory menstural cyle. Also, the relative proportion and level of each IGFBP did not correlated with serum 17beta-estradiol level. There was no significant difference in the relative proportion and level of each serum IGFBP between on the day of ovulation in normal ovulatory menstrual cylce and on the day of aspiration of oocyte in controlled hyperstimulated cycle. Our data indicate that IGFBPs have regulatory functions in ovary through an paracrine and autocrine rather than endocrine mechanism during normal ovulatory menstural cycle.

3.Insulin-Like Growth Factors and Their Bindign Proteins in Uterine Leiomyoma Pretreated with Gonadtropin Releasing Hormone Agonist.
Ki Chul KIM ; Jung Gu KIM ; Jin Yong LEE
Journal of Korean Society of Endocrinology 1997;12(3):364-375
BACKGROUND: Uterine leiomyoma is the most common pelvic tumor, occurring in 20-25% of women in reproductive age. Gonadotropin releasing hormone agonist (GnRHa) has been reognized as a temporary medical management for this disorder. The etiology of these tumors is unknown but it has been shown that the insulin-like growth factors (IGF-I, IGF-II) are promoters of growth in nongynecologic tumors. Several recent studies have suggested the possible role of IGFs in human leiomyoma growth. The IGF binding proteins (IGFBPs) are believed to modulate actions of IGF and to have IGF-independent actions. The purpose of this study was to evaluate the type of IGF and IGFBP which may be involved in leiomyoma growth and to investigate a possible IGF related mechanism of action of GnRHa. METHOD: The IGFs and IGFBPs were measured by double antibody radioimmunoassay, western ligand blot and immunoprecipitation in the tissue cytosols of normal uterine myometria (n=15), nontumorous myometria adjacent to a leiomyoma and leiomyoma from patients nontreated (n=15) and treated (n=10) with GnRHa. RESULTS: The mean IGF-I and IGF-II level were significantly higher in leiomyoma from untreated patients than in the adjacent myometrium and normal myometrium but no significant differences in these IGF levels between normal myometrium and adjacent myometrium were noted. The IGFBP-2, IGFBP-3 and 26kDa IGFBP were detected variably but IGFBP-4 was consistently present in all tissues. There were no significant differences in the relative intensity for IGFBP-4 and the frequency of IGFBPs between leiomyoma, adjacent myometrium and normal myometrium from untreated patients. The IGF-I, IGF-II levels and the relative intensity of IGFBP-4 in leiomyoma from GnRHa-treated patients were significantly lower than those in untreated patients, but these levels in the adjacent myometrium were comparable. The frequency of each IGFBP in leiomyoma and the adjacent myornetrium from GnRHa-treated patients did not significantly differ from untreated patients. CONCLUSION: Both IGF-I and IGF-II are involved in the growth of leiomyoma and GnRHa may in part act to decrease size of leiomyoma by regulating the local levels of IGF-I, IGF-II and IGFBP-4.

4.Mutagenicity of Human Urine Excreted after Ingestion of Roast Beef.
Dong Gu SHIN ; Jung Hee KIM ; Jae Ryong KIM
Yeungnam University Journal of Medicine 1987;4(2):105-111
This study was undertaken to observe the mutagenic occurrence in urine excreted after the ingestion of roast beef. Two healthy nonsmoker persons of both sex were selected for this test, employing two strains (TA98, TA100) of Salmonella typhimurium according to Ames' method. The mutagenic activity began to appear in urine of both sex three hours after ingestion of 300 g of roast beef, gradually increasing until 6 hours and declining thereafter.

8.The Genetic Polymorphism of Alpha 2-Heremans Schmidt Glycoprotein (AHSG), and Antibody to AHSG in Patients with Endometriosis.
Korean Journal of Obstetrics and Gynecology 2004;47(5):938-945
OBJECTIVE: To investigate the relationship among alpha 2-Heremans Schmidt glycoprotein (AHSG) polymorphism, anti-AHSG antibody and endometriosis in Korean women. METHODS: AHSG polymorphism was analyzed by restriction fragment length polymorphism and DNA sequencing in 79 women with endometriosis, and 105 women with normal pelviscopic finding. Anti-AHSG antibody was measured using enzyme linked immuosorbent assay. RESULTS: The allele frequencies of AHSG 1 and AHSG 2 were 0.69 and 0.31 respectively. The proportion of noncarrier of AHSG 2 allele was significantly higher (p<0.05) in women with endometriosis than in women without endometriosis (55.7% versus 39.0%). Women not carrying AHSG 2 allele have 2 times higher risk of endometriosis than women carrying at least one this allele. Positive rate of anti-AHSG antibody was significantly higher in women with endometriosis (20.0%) than women without endometriosis (2.7%). There were no significant differences in the distribution of AHSG allele or AHSG genotypes and in positivity of anti-AHSG antibody between early stage endometriosis and late stage endometriosis. No significant difference in positivity of anti-AHSG antibody was noted among AHSG genotypes. CONCLUSION: AHSG polymorphism and anti-AHSG antibody is associated with endometriosis, but the positivity of anti-AHSG antibody does not depend on AHSG genotypes.

10.A Clinical Analysis of Vitrectomy for the Proliferative Diabetic Retinopathy Patients.
Chul Gu KIM ; Yeon Chul JUNG ; Jong Woo KIM
Journal of the Korean Ophthalmological Society 1998;39(1):104-110
The authors reviewed the charts of 128 patients(160 eyes) who underwent vitrectomy for the proliferative diabetic retinopathy from January 1993 to December 1995 and the results were analyzed in terms of visual efficiency. At the conclusion of the study, visual acuity improved in 96 eyes(60%), unchanged in 33 eyes(21%) and in 31 eyes(19%) became worse. Visual efficiency was increased from 11.9% preoperatively to 37.2% postoperatively in all patients. Patients under the age of 40 showed better results than the patients above the age of 40. The factors which affected the change in visual efficiency were age and preoperative intraocular conditions. The patients who had non-clearing vitreous hemorrhage without proliferative membrane revealed better prognostic results than the other patients. In 50 eyes (31.3%) of cases, maximal postoperative visual acuity was achieved in 4 weeks to 3 months after operation.
